Senior Officers of Distt Admin inspect functioning of essential services across Ang

Anantnag: On the directions of Deputy Commissioner (DC) Anantnag, DrBasharatQayoom, senior officers of the District Administration visited several areas of the district and took stock of the functioning of essential services, control rooms, Snow clearance in the interiors and health facilities here on Saturday.
Deputy Commissioner Anantnag said that the purpose of these visits is to ensure that clearance operations as well as working of essential services are maintained not only in towns but also in villages and remote areas of the district. He emphasized that control rooms, both at District and sub district levels are actively answering any calls for help and people should feel free to reach out to these for any assistance.
The Additional District Development Commissioner (ADDC) Anantnag visited several parts of Anantnag town and inspected the Snow clearance operations in residential areas. He inspected the clearance of lanes and service roads.
He also inspected the functioning of KPDCL workshop at Lazibal where directions were issued for time bound replacement of affected transformers.
The ADDC later visited JanglatMandi and MCCH Anantnag.
Additional Deputy Commissioner (ADC) Anantnag accompanied by SDM Dooru, Executive Engineer R&B Qazigund, TehsildarQazigund, AEE KPDCL and EO MC visited several parts of Qazigund area. He interacted with staff from KPDCL who assured the visiting officer that all feeders have been charged and they are ready to tackle any outages.
He visited SDH Qazigund and PHCs in the area to take stock of the health facilities being extended to patients.
The ADC also visited the R&B Control Room in Qazigund and issued directions for ensuring immediate Snow clearance in case of fresh Snowfall. He also inspected the responses to various calls received by the control room.
Another Additional Deputy Commissioner (ADC) visited Mattan and Aishmuqam areas in the district.
Accompanied by CMO Anantnag, he inspected the functioning of SDH Seer and PHC Mattan. Interacting with MC officials in both areas, he stressed on ensuring all lanes and interiors are clean and ready for use by pedestrians. He also appealed people to exercise caution while venturing outside due to slippery conditions.
The ADC took stock of the water supply in Mattan and Seer and was informed that Jal Shakti staff are ready to address any supply issues. He called for swift responses to help calls received in control rooms, particularly in view of the heavy tourist movement in the area.
Similarly, SDM Bijbehara also inspected the clearance in the interiors of Bijbehara, Srigufwara areas. He said that lanes and interior roads in towns as well as villages in Srigufwara and Bijbehara have been cleaned. He said Snow clearance wherever pending will be completed by the next day. He said roads leading to health facilities are operational and sub divisional control rooms are activated for any assistance.
